Abstract

This study examines the impact of Microsoft Access as a tool for improving secondary students’ proficiency in mathematical operations, focusing on algebraic expressions and basic statistical computations. A randomized controlled trial involved 80 students (aged 15–17) split into an experimental group (n=40) using Microsoft Access queries and a control group (n=40) employing traditional methods. The intervention included tasks such as solving linear equations and calculating statistical measures (mean, variance) within Access databases. Pre- and post-intervention assessments showed the experimental group improved significantly (p < 0.001), with a mean post-test score of 88.6 (SD = 6.9) compared to 74.3 (SD = 7.8) for the control group. Student surveys indicated higher motivation and perceived relevance in the experimental group. These findings suggest that Microsoft Access can enhance mathematical skills by integrating computational practice with data management, offering a novel approach to mathematics education.
